Output 943a64fc18a7e43be022b2129c7f1201d3d76c453669ba46aba24f347f49da18:1

value
2572068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e64637d062943324b2f88c1f6c87e9a125988b OP_EQUAL
address
39XDDb2R4YsV3rjWYp5tdKgccPmNjRtC8i
transaction
943a64fc18a7e43be022b2129c7f1201d3d76c453669ba46aba24f347f49da18
spent
true